Job description

As a Data Scientist , you will play an important role in turning complex data into insights and predictive models that support supply chain, manufacturing, quality, purchasing, and science & technology. This is a great opportunity for someone who wants to apply advanced analytics to meaningful business challenges and help shape decisions that impact client’s mission.

In this role,

  • You will partner closely with Procurement business users to understand their needs and recommend solutions that anticipate future changes.
  • You will design and build AI solutions utilizing data across structured and unstructured sources, including large datasets and batch or streaming environments.
  • You will develop advanced analytical models using supervised and unsupervised machine learning, statistical methods, and predictive modeling.
  • You will also create reports and dashboards that clearly communicate findings, and you may mentor and coach team members as part of your day-to-day work.
